Summary

This tale of espionage from the author of "Moscow Rules" and "Death Beam", is set in Germany between the wars. Johnny Lentz, a young Berliner joins the Communist party, in the hope of combating the Nazis. He soon discovers that he has entered a world of intrigue and double bluff.
